使用 Django 的 `FileResponse` 实现文件下载与在线预览
使用 Django 的 FileResponse 实现文件下载与在线预览 在现代 Web 应用中,文件下载和在线预览是两个非常常见的需求。Django 作为一个流行的 Python Web 框架,提供了 FileResponse 类来方便地处理这些需求。本文将详细介绍如何使用 FileResponse 来实现…
2025-11-05数据库设计中,物理结构设计 是确保数据库高效存储和快速访问的关键一步。虽然数据库的物理结构依赖于所选的数据库管理系统(DBMS),但理解并合理设计数据库的物理结构,是每个数据库设计人员必须掌握的技能。本文将深入浅…
文章目录 前言1. 安装docker与docker-compose2. 启动容器运行镜像3. 本地访问测试4.安装内网穿透5. 创建公网地址6. 创建固定公网地址 前言 今天和大家分享一款在G站获得了26K的强大的开源在线协作笔记软件,Trilium Notes的中文版如何在Linux环境使用docker本地部署…
使用 Django 的 FileResponse 实现文件下载与在线预览 在现代 Web 应用中,文件下载和在线预览是两个非常常见的需求。Django 作为一个流行的 Python Web 框架,提供了 FileResponse 类来方便地处理这些需求。本文将详细介绍如何使用 FileResponse 来实现…
2025-11-05目录: 一.网络基本的概念: 二. 封装和分用 (网络转发): 一.网络基本的概念: 1..局域网 (LAN): 局域网,即 Local Area Network,简称LAN。 Local 即标识了局域网是本地,局部组建的…
2025-11-05一.环境搭建 1.靶场描述 Difficulty : mediumKeywords : curl, bash, code review This works better with VirtualBox rather than VMware 2.靶场下载 https://download.vulnhub.com/momentum/Momentum2.ova 3.靶场启动 二.信息收集 1.寻找靶场真实的IP地址 nmap -sP 10.0.…
2025-11-04repal 驱逐 shelter 避难所 slum 贫民窟 utilize 使用 utility 公共设施,实用 appliance 器具 apply:应用 mechanism 机械装置 capacity 能力,容量 capable 有能力的 confidential 机密的 classify 分类 dedicate 奉献于 delicate 精致的精美的 crunch…
2025-11-04问题征兆 在内网环境使用anaconda创建新环境: conda create --name py39 python3.9由于网络原因,遇到如下报错: Retrying (Retry(total2, connectNone, readNone, redirectNone, statusNone)) after connection broken by NewConnectionEr…
2025-11-04MyBatis提供了9种动态SQL标签:trim、where、set、foreach、if、choose、when、otherwise、bind; 1.if 标签 <select id"getUser">select * from User<where><if test" age ! null ">and age > #{age}</if…
2025-11-041. 背景介绍 在现代数据科学和机器学习领域,我们经常面临一个复杂的挑战:如何在一个统一的系统中集成和管理多个不同语言、不同环境依赖的模型。我们的团队最近就遇到了这样一个有趣而富有挑战性的需求。 我们的Web应用原本是一个基于Python的系统&…
2025-11-04网络协议–HTTP 和 HTTPS 的区别 一、简述 HTTP (全称 Hyper Text Transfer Protocol),就是超文本传输协议,用来在 Internet 上传送超文本。是互联网上应用最为广泛的一种网络协议,是一个客户端和服务器端请求和应答的标准(TCP),…
2025-11-04云计算计算模式的演进 一、云计算计算模式的起源追溯1.2 个人计算机与桌面计算 二、云计算计算模式的发展阶段2.1 效用计算的出现2.2 客户机/服务器模式2.3 集群计算2.4 服务计算2.5 分布式计算2.6 网格计算 三、云计算计算模式的成熟与多元化3.1 主流云计算服务模式的确立3.1.…
2025-11-04第一步先处理重名的数据 , 解决方法 :将相同名字的图片或文件后面加后缀数字作为区分 let arr [{name:图片一,url:http://cdn}, {name:图片一,url:http://cdn}, {name:图片二,url:http://cdn}]; // 创建一个对象来跟踪已经遇到的名称和它们的计数 le…
2025-11-04👋 项目介绍 SafeLine,中文名 “雷池”,是一款简单好用, 效果突出的 Web 应用防火墙(WAF),可以保护 Web 服务不受黑客攻击。 雷池通过过滤和监控 Web 应用与互联网之间的 HTTP 流量来保护 Web 服务。可以保护 Web 服务免受 SQL …
2025-11-04本程序会根据原文字图片,自动扣字并生成黑字、红字2个透明的png图片,原图片黑字或白字均可。运行的话需要先安装好 ImageMagick-7.1.1-37 用法与生成效果举例: a.jpg 白字 转 黑、红扣字png: b.jpg 黑字 转 黑、红扣字png: 分享脚本如下: …
2025-11-04本文主要介绍国外google上线的app 短信自动填充方案。 本方案主要是使用google提出的,防止开发者使用SMS相关权限造成的用户信息泄露 目录 注意点: 1、本方式不适合华为手机,华为有自己的获取方式 2、本方式不需要添加任何短信权限 3、…
2025-11-04💓 博客主页:瑕疵的CSDN主页 📝 Gitee主页:瑕疵的gitee主页 ⏩ 文章专栏:《热点资讯》 区块链技术在版权保护中的应用 区块链技术在版权保护中的应用 区块链技术在版权保护中的应用 引言 区块链技术概述 定义与原理 发…
2025-11-04执行结果:通过 执行用时和内存消耗如下: 题目:新增道路查询后的最短距离① 给你一个整数 n 和一个二维整数数组 queries。 有 n 个城市,编号从 0 到 n - 1。初始时,每个城市 i 都有一条单向道路通往城市 i 1( 0 &l…
2025-11-04计算机系统 大作业 题 目 程序人生-Hello’s P2P 专 业 计算机与电子通信类 学 号 2023112915 班 级 23L0505 学 生 杨昕彦 指 导 教 师 刘宏伟 计算机科学…
2025-11-04贪⼼算法是两极分化很严重的算法。简单的问题会让你觉得理所应当,难⼀点的问题会让你怀疑⼈⽣ 什么是贪⼼算法? 贪⼼算法,或者说是贪⼼策略:企图⽤局部最优找出全局最优。 把解决问题的过程分成若⼲步;解决每⼀步时…
2025-11-04零、前言 因为要在ubuntu上做点东西,发现git clone 的时候必须输账户密码,后来发现密码是token,但是token一大串太烦了,忙了一天发现可以通过配置 公钥 来 替代 http 的 部署方式。 一、生成 ssh 密钥对 我们先测试下能不能 连接…
2025-11-04重构测试项目为springspringMVCMybatis框架 背景 继上次将自动化测试时的医药管理信息系统项目用idea运行成功后,由于项目结构有些乱,一部分代码好像也重复,于是打算重新重构以下该项目,这次先使用springspringMVCMybatis框架 …
2025-11-04PyTorch量化技术教程:PyTorch核心组件详解 本教程旨在为读者提供一套全面且深入的PyTorch技术在量化交易领域应用的知识体系。系统涵盖PyTorch基础入门、核心组件详解、模型构建与训练,以及在A股市场中的实战应用。采用理论与实战深度融合的讲解模式&…
2025-11-04